E-Commerce Platforms vs CMS: Choosing the Right System for Your Online Business
E-Commerce Platforms vs CMS: Choosing the Right System for Your Online Business
Blog Article
In today’s rapidly evolving digital marketplace, businesses face a critical decision when establishing their online presence: should they build their website using an e-commerce platform or a content management system (CMS)? While both tools offer unique benefits, choosing the wrong one can lead to limited functionality, slower scalability, and a poor customer experience.
In this article, we’ll break down the fundamental differences between e-commerce platforms and CMS solutions, compare leading tools like Shopify, WooCommerce, Magento, and WordPress, and help you decide which is best for your business goals.
Table of Contents
Introduction to E-Commerce Platforms and CMS
What Is an E-Commerce Platform?
What Is a CMS (Content Management System)?
Key Differences Between E-Commerce Platforms and CMS
Popular E-Commerce Platforms
Leading CMS Options
Pros and Cons of E-Commerce Platforms
Pros and Cons of CMS
Which Is Right for You: E-Commerce Platform vs CMS?
Headless Commerce: The Best of Both Worlds?
How Theplanetsoft Helps You Choose and Build the Right Platform
Final Thoughts
1. Introduction to E-Commerce Platforms and CMS
In building a digital storefront or website, businesses typically choose between:
A dedicated e-commerce platform, which focuses on product listing, shopping carts, payments, and shipping.
A CMS, which prioritizes content creation, blog publishing, and flexible web design, sometimes with e-commerce plugins.
While these tools can overlap in functionality, they serve distinct purposes. Understanding these differences is crucial to scaling effectively and meeting customer expectations.
2. What Is an E-Commerce Platform?
An e-commerce platform is a software solution specifically designed to help businesses create and manage online stores. These platforms streamline the entire sales process—from product listings and inventory management to secure payments and shipping integration.
Key Features:
Product catalog management
Shopping cart and checkout
Payment gateway integration
Order and inventory tracking
Customer accounts and analytics
Marketing and promotions tools
Shipping, taxes, and returns support
Popular examples include Shopify, BigCommerce, Magento, and Wix eCommerce.
3. What Is a CMS (Content Management System)?
A CMS is a platform designed for creating, managing, and publishing digital content—primarily websites and blogs. It allows non-technical users to maintain a website using a user-friendly backend interface.
Key Features:
Content creation and editing tools
Page and layout management
Media file organization
Plugin and theme support
User management
SEO and performance plugins
Blog and article publishing
Popular CMSs include WordPress, Drupal, and Joomla. Many CMSs can be extended with e-commerce plugins, like WooCommerce for WordPress.
4. Key Differences Between E-Commerce Platforms and CMS
Feature | E-Commerce Platform | CMS |
---|---|---|
Primary Purpose | Online selling and transactions | Content publishing and management |
Built-in E-Commerce | Native, with full feature set | Requires third-party plugins |
Customization | Moderate (template-driven) | High (with developer support) |
Ease of Use | Beginner-friendly | Slightly steeper learning curve |
Content Management | Limited | Advanced |
SEO & Blogging | Basic (unless extended) | Extensive tools |
Scalability | High (with hosted platforms) | Depends on hosting and setup |
5. Popular E-Commerce Platforms
1. Shopify
Fully hosted, all-in-one platform
Easy to use with minimal setup
Great for small to mid-sized businesses
App store with powerful extensions
Limited flexibility for custom code
2. Magento (Adobe Commerce)
Self-hosted or cloud-based
Enterprise-level performance
Highly customizable, developer-driven
Advanced features and scalability
Steeper learning curve and higher cost
3. BigCommerce
SaaS platform with robust features
Integrates easily with CMSs like WordPress
Powerful B2B functionality
No transaction fees
Less flexible in design than Shopify
4. Wix eCommerce
Beginner-friendly
Drag-and-drop design tools
Ideal for small businesses
Limited scalability
6. Leading CMS Options
1. WordPress (with WooCommerce)
World’s most popular CMS
Massive plugin ecosystem
WooCommerce adds full e-commerce functionality
Highly customizable with themes and code
Requires regular updates and security management
2. Drupal
Enterprise-grade CMS
Strong taxonomy and content structure
Ideal for complex sites with custom permissions
E-commerce support via Commerce module
Developer-intensive
3. Joomla
Balance of usability and flexibility
Good access control and multilingual support
Extensions available for e-commerce
Not as popular or supported as WordPress
7. Pros and Cons of E-Commerce Platforms
✅ Pros:
Ready-to-sell out of the box
Built-in security and PCI compliance
Scalable hosting and support
Integrated analytics and payment solutions
Minimal setup required
❌ Cons:
Monthly fees and transaction charges
Limited flexibility in some platforms
Less control over SEO and content
Dependent on vendor ecosystem
8. Pros and Cons of CMS
✅ Pros:
Excellent for content-driven sites (blogs, news, etc.)
Highly customizable
Large developer and plugin community
Better SEO control
Lower initial cost (open-source options)
❌ Cons:
Needs setup and hosting
Requires regular maintenance and updates
E-commerce must be added through plugins
Potential for plugin conflicts or security issues
9. Which Is Right for You: E-Commerce Platform vs CMS?
Your ideal platform depends on your business needs, goals, and technical expertise.
Business Need | Recommended Option |
---|---|
Starting a simple online store | Shopify, BigCommerce |
Selling and blogging simultaneously | WordPress + WooCommerce |
Large-scale enterprise solution | Magento or Headless CMS |
Advanced content strategy with products | WordPress or Drupal |
B2B commerce with complex pricing | BigCommerce, Magento |
Questions to Ask Yourself:
Do I need rich content management (blogs, guides)?
Is speed to market critical?
What level of customization do I need?
Will I scale across multiple regions or channels?
Do I have in-house technical skills?
10. Headless Commerce: The Best of Both Worlds?
Headless commerce decouples the frontend (CMS) from the backend (e-commerce engine), giving businesses the flexibility to use best-in-class tools for each.
For example:
Use WordPress or a headless CMS like Strapi to manage content
Connect it to a Shopify or BigCommerce backend via APIs
Serve content on web, mobile, and IoT devices simultaneously
Benefits:
Ultimate customization
Faster performance (Jamstack approach)
Better omnichannel experience
Separation of concerns between marketing and engineering
While it requires more setup, headless commerce offers unparalleled flexibility and future-proofing.
11. How Theplanetsoft Helps You Choose and Build the Right Platform
At Theplanetsoft, we specialize in helping businesses select, customize, and optimize the right platform for their digital goals—whether it’s a CMS, an e-commerce solution, or a hybrid architecture.
Our Services Include:
Platform selection (based on needs analysis)
Shopify, WooCommerce, Magento, and Headless setups
Custom theme and plugin development
Integration with payment, CRM, ERP, and marketing tools
Performance tuning, SEO, and security hardening
Post-launch maintenance and scale planning
Whether you're building a niche product store or a content-driven commerce site, Theplanetsoft ensures you're on the right foundation for growth.
12. Final Thoughts
Choosing between an e-commerce platform and a CMS is more than just a technical decision—it’s a strategic one. While platforms like Shopify offer simplicity and speed, CMSs like WordPress provide unmatched flexibility and content control.
The right choice depends on your business type, product complexity, content needs, and long-term goals. And for businesses seeking the best of both worlds, headless commerce solutions offer a future-ready path.
Need help deciding or building your digital storefront?
Contact Theplanetsoft to get a customized consultation and take your online business to the next level.
Report this page